FineMark National Bank & Trust's Q4 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2015, FineMark National Bank & Trust held 1,582 positions worth $837M, up 13% from $741M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

FineMark National Bank & Trust deployed $54.3M of net new capital in Q4 2015, opening 69 new positions and adding to 371 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Alphabet (Google) Class C: 256,360 shares worth $9.73M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 12% of assets, down from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Phillips 66, an estimated $3.96M trimmed.
